概括
土壤真核生物多样性主要是由生态系统类型驱动的,耕地支持更高和更专业的社区. 长期的环境因素和土壤特性显著塑造了这些土壤社区.

背景情况:
- 土壤真核生物对生态系统功能至关重要,但它们的多样性驱动因素尚不清楚.
- 之前对土壤真核生物的研究在空间规模和分类学范围上是有限的.
- 了解土壤真核细胞组合对于生态系统管理和保护至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 研究环境条件对土壤真核细胞多样性和大陆范围内的分布的影响.
- 确定塑造欧洲土壤真核生物群落组成和结构的关键因素.
- 为了比较不同生态系统类型和土壤特性对土壤真核生物群落的影响.
主要方法:
- 分析了来自欧洲787个地点的大量观测数据.
- 对土壤真核体的评估,包括真菌,原生虫,虫,虫,线虫,节肢动物和类动物.
- 社区组成与各种气候,地表和生态系统类型变量之间的相关性分析.
主要成果:
- 生态系统类型是塑造土壤真核生物多样性的主要因素,农田表现出更高和更专业的社区.
- 土壤的特性,如pH值,植物可用的和土壤有机碳与总的比率,显著影响了各种真核生物群体的丰富性.
- 叠加的分类标志着过去土地使用的DNA积累,反映了欧洲最近的土地转型.
结论:
- 长期的环境变量,而不是短期的测量,对于理解土壤真核生物群落至关重要.
- 生态系统类型和特定的土壤特性是土壤真核生物多样性和分布的关键驱动因素.
- 未来的监测和保护工作应纳入长期变量和生态系统类型,以有效地管理土壤健康.

Diversity of Protists I
38
Excavata is a diverse group of protists that includes both chemoorganotrophic and phototrophic species, with some thriving in anaerobic environments. Among the key groups within Excavata are diplomonads and parabasalids, which are flagellated protists that lack mitochondria and chloroplasts. These microorganisms typically inhabit anoxic environments, such as the intestines of animals, where they exist either symbiotically or as parasites, relying on fermentation for energy production. Diversity of Protists IV
40
Amoebozoa represent a diverse group of terrestrial and aquatic protists that utilize lobe-shaped pseudopodia for locomotion and feeding. This characteristic differentiates them from the Rhizaria, which possess threadlike pseudopodia. The primary classifications within Amoebozoa include gymnamoebas, entamoebas, and the plasmodial and cellular slime molds. Diversity of Protists II
50
Alveolates are a group of organisms recognized by the presence of alveoli, which are cytoplasmic sacs located beneath the cell membrane. While their function remains uncertain, alveoli may help regulate water balance by controlling how much water enters and leaves the cell. In dinoflagellates, these structures may serve as armor plates. Diversity of Protists III
51
Rhizaria are a diverse group of unicellular protists characterized by their threadlike cytoplasmic extensions known as pseudopodia. These structures aid in both locomotion and feeding, giving Rhizaria an amoeboid appearance.
